Sitges is a stunning place. It's a nice, calm contrast to busy Barcelona, yet only a quick ride away.
The historical city is beautiful at every turn, and the beach makes for a gorgeous visit.
I've been to Barcelona a handful of times and always find new things to do. I love the sunny weather, and the vibrant energy of the city. The food and wine scene is incredible, and best of all - Barcelona is so well-connected as an international hub.
The biggest challenge in visiting Barcelona is pick-pocketing and theft. It is very common here. After visiting 70+ countries, and countless cities as an avid traveler, this is the only city where I've had something stolen from me.
Vancouver is a safe place to travel for solo travellers or groups. There may be limited attractions and experiences compared to larger cities, but we have mountains and water everywhere that make up for it. If you enjoy being surrounded by nature while also enjoying multicultural cuisine and great views, you'll love Vancouver.

Chiang Mai is a perfect base for exploring Northern Thailand, great foodie destination and a great place to immerse yourself in the Northern Thai culture and history. It feels more like a large village than a city, but that's a good thing for me.
Be aware of the smokey season with very bad air quality in March and April.
